6. during the update back up these configuration files The installer will function correctly even if clients have changed their Oracle port number Do not write over the properties files with a backup from an earlier release after running the updater The update may include new properties Writing over a properties file will remove these new properties and may cause the system to fail Instead compare the old properties file with the new properties file to ensure that any important customizations are still in place in the new properties file Customizations made to other Blackboard files and third party files configured by Blackboard such as authentication properties and Tomcat and Apache configuration files will also not be preserved during the update The following information explains how configurations may be changed by the application pack installer e After an update the SSL certificate is preserved but the settings must be reapplied to the collab server Edit the server xml bb file prior to updating to Application Pack 3 to include the SSL configuration information e Anew template is included to support the bbstats database connection pooling The deployment for this template will remove the configuration for bbadmin and virtual installation connection pooling A backup of the configuration is saved in the backups lt updateversion gt directory Administrators must manually restore the configuration after the installation is complete

18. content item users see a Mark Reviewed icon from the course view When users have completed their review of the item they click the Mark Reviewed button The item then displays a Reviewed icon The Instructor can view progress from the Performance Dashboard or the User Progress page in the Control Panel Instructors enable and disable review from the new Manage page available on all content items Default Availability This feature is enabled by default in both courses and organizations Follow the steps below to disable Review Status for courses Select Settings under Blackboard Learning System on the Administrator Panel Select Manage Tools Select Modify next to Review Status Course Tool Select Yes next to Available and click Submit amp UNH Follow the steps below to disable Review Status for organizations 1 Select Settings under Blackboard Community System Organizations on the Administrator Panel 2 Select Manage Tools 3 Select Modify next to Review Status Organization Tool 4 Select Yes next to Available and click Submit Product Requirements Review Status is not available in the Blackboard Learning System Basic Edition Syllabus Builder The Syllabus Builder is an easy to use content item that makes Syllabus creation the most basic element of any course simple for Instructors of all levels with a feature that allows them to easily apply designs to their work Syllabi can contain general class informa
19. e 6 3 Blackboard recommends Service Pack 1 for those clients running the Blackboard Academic Suite on the Windows 2003 operating system in a one or two server environment Service Pack 1 fixes a problem in IIS 6 that results in slower than normal download speeds when the end user is running the Internet Explorer browser Those clients that are running the Blackboard Academic Suite in a load balanced environment should not install Service Pack 1 for Windows 2003 Service Pack 1 is not compatible with the DFS file shares used to connect the Web application servers to the file server Blackboard Academic Suite Release 7 0 updates the configuration of load balanced environments to use UNC shares rather than DFS Release 7 0 will require that clients go through a simple process to switch from DFS to UNC shares Once the change is made to UNC shares clients can safely install Service Pack 1 for Windows 2003 NET Building Blocks Clients running the Blackboard Academic Suite on a Windows Operating System must install the NET framework if they plan on using NET Building Blocks Server Compatibility Server software must meet certain requirements before installing the Blackboard Academic Suite Release 6 3 The following are important to keep in mind when setting up the server software e The database is run on a separate server when using two or more servers Thus appropriate client tools for the database must be installed on the Web Applicati

23. ed Update the bbcms install properties located in the blackboard apps bbcems config Change the Xythos license key property to set the new key Run the push cs config update command Run the PushConfigUpdates command for the Blackboard Learning System PWNE 2005 Blackboard Inc Proprietary and Confidential page 44 Blackboard Academic Suite Application Pack 3 Release Notes RESOLVED ISSUES About Resolved Issues Application Pack 3 Release 6 3 includes a number of fixes to issues discovered in earlier releases The resolved issues reported here have been fixed since the release of Blackboard Learning System Release 6 2 Resolved Issues Report A full report of the Resolved Issues may be found in the Reference Center at http behind blackboard com Please contact Blackboard Product Support for additional information about any issue 2005 Blackboard Inc Proprietary and Confidential page 45 KNOWN ISSUE INFORMATION About Known Issues A known issue is a software problem with the Blackboard Learning System Blackboard Community System or Blackboard Content System When a known issue is fixed it is listed as a resolved issue Issues included in Known Issues An Issue must meet the following requirements to be included in the Release Notes An issue is included if it is a problem with the software Questions about how a feature works and requests for new features are not included Many times questions
24. ed in Application Pack 1 or Application Pack 2 are automatically enabled This means that after the update these features are automatically turned on in the system This section includes instructions on how to disable each of these features Spell Check The Spell Check feature is available wherever users can enter blocks of text The Spell Check feature supports a full English dictionary a supplemental word list configured by the System Administrator and custom word lists that are stored as a cookie on a user s local machine Spell Check is enabled for the English locale only If Spell Check is disabled it may not be used anywhere on the system including in courses and organizations Follow the steps below to disable Spell Check 1 Select Text Box Editor on the Administrator Panel 2 Uncheck the Spell Check Available option and click Submit Product Requirements Spell Check is available with all products in the Blackboard Academic Suite Quick Edit Quick Edit allows Instructors to make changes to content from within the course view instead of navigating through the Control Panel to edit content Quick Edit is enabled by default for courses and organizations This feature cannot be turned off Product Requirements Quick Edit is available with all products in the Blackboard Academic Suite Glossary Each course has its own Glossary of terms Each entry consists of the term and an accompanying definition The Glossary must be enabled

29. f the Blackboard file system and database The Updater does not include an uninstaller and only preserves backups of the files modified during the update NorE Information on updating platforms for example setting up Red Hat Linux Advanced Server 3 0 is located in the UNIX Setup Guide Updating to Oracle 9i Administrators who update their database to Oracle 9i as part of the Application Pack 3 update need to make a SQL modification to enable statistics gathering After the update is complete run the following as sys user grant SELECT CATALOG ROLE to bb bb60 grant select on v parameter to bb bb60 grant SELECT CATALOG ROLE to bbadmin grant select on v parameter to bbadmin grant SELECT CATALOG ROLE to bb bb60 stats grant select on v parameter to bb bb60 stats Directory error message Clients who have installed a build prior to Release 6 1 0 1 as their initial Blackboard Learning System Release 6 0 installation may receive an error message during the update to Application Pack 3 This is due to a missing setting in the bb config properties for bbconfig setup type The following is an example of the error message Please specify a directory or press Enter to accept the default directory Directory Name usr local blackboard Press 1 for Next 2 for Previous 3 to Cancel or 4 to Redisplay 1 You are attempting to install over an existing Blackboard snapshot client installation The bbconfig setup type should

32. ime stamp directory is located within the location above providing access to the files that were modified or deleted each time the installer was run Log File The installer log file may be found at the following location Blackboard installation directory logs bb updater log txt Troubleshooting The installer verifies that certain requirements are met before modifying the Blackboard Learning System installation This includes confirming the location of the Blackboard Learning System installation and verifying the version of the current installation Errors may occur while running the installer An error message may appear during the installation and Administrators may check the log file to look for errors Issues that may cause an error include supplying the incorrect location of the Blackboard Learning System installation or the system being unable to find the Java Virtual Machine These problems may be remedied and the Application Pack installer run again If advanced technical issues arise or the source of the error cannot be detected contact Blackboard Product Support at http behind blackboard com for assistance During installation users may receive an error message stating that no matching JVM was found If this occurs create a link to the location of the JDK when running the command to start the installer as shown in the example below Windows UNIX Solaris solarisBbUpdater bin is javahome usr jdk5 0 Linu

38. ng the Blackboard Learning System updater Once the Blackboard Content System is updated the Blackboard Learning System updater is no longer needed Warning Blackboard Content System Release 2 0 2 3 must be installed before updating to Release 2 3 Requirements Ensure that the following requirements are met before installing the Blackboard Content System e The system meets the hardware and software requirements published in the Blackboard Content System Hardware Software Guide e A valid key for installing the Blackboard Content System e The Blackboard Content System is using Java 2 SE 5 0 e Ifthe Blackboard Content System is running on two or more servers ensure that each server is set to the same time and the same time zone e lf using an Oracle database ensure that the National Character Set is UTF 8 For instructions on how to change the Oracle National Character Set please the Blackboard Content System Installation and Setup Manual SQL Server users may skip this step Disable lock escalation Windows only Administrators who are using Microsoft SQL Server should disable lock escalation by enabling trace flag 1211 Follow the steps below to disable lock escalation 1 Right click the server in SQL Enterprise Manager to add a server startup parameter 2 Select Properties 3 Choose Startup Properties on the General tab 4 Add the following parameter as shown including the dash T1211 Disabling this trace flag di

45. r only 2005 Blackboard Inc Proprietary and Confidential page 42 Common Installation Issues The following are some of the most common problems encountered during installation and how to resolve them Issue The License Key has been entered incorrectly Solution When entering the Blackboard Content System License Key check that the case is not changed If cutting and pasting the license key check that there are no additional characters or spaces at the end of the key Issue Oracle only The Character Set in the Oracle Database is set to UTF8 before the Blackboard Content System was installed but the data migration during this procedure was corrupted Users may experience confusing text within the application and data related errors Solution Check the Character Set before installing the Blackboard Content System See the topic Character Sets Issue Inaccurate information is included in the bb config properties file If this occurs issues with functionality will appear throughout the application Solution The installer uses the database connection and other information stored in the bb config properties file Always check that the information in this file is correct Troubleshooting If there is a problem during the installation process check the installation logs located in the blackboard logs directory bb fs install log This log contains the output from the file system portion of the installer
